Skip to content

v1.28.0

v1.28.0 #34

Workflow file for this run

name: Binaries
on:
release:
types:
- released
jobs:
compile:
runs-on: ${{ matrix.os }}
strategy:
matrix:
os: [ ubuntu-latest, macos-latest ]
sdk: [ stable ]
steps:
- uses: actions/checkout@v4
- uses: dart-lang/setup-dart@v1
with:
sdk: ${{ matrix.sdk }}
- name: Install dependencies
run: make install
- name: Build runners
run: make build_runner
- name: compile
run: make compile
- name: Install zip
if: matrix.os == 'ubuntu-latest'
run: sudo apt-get install -y zip
- name: zip
run: zip -j "${{matrix.os}}.zip" dist/devmy
- name: compile
run: rm dist/devmy
- name: Release
uses: softprops/action-gh-release@v2
with:
files: "${{matrix.os}}.zip"